只是好奇有两个不同的库处理Doctrine2行为/扩展(loggable,timestampable等):KNPLabs DoctrineBehaviors和Atlantic18 DoctrineExtensions,似乎继续Gediminas的工作.
他们的主要区别是什么?
我可以看到Atlantic18支持多个驱动程序,而KNPLabs不支持,它还有一些功能(Sortable,IpTraceable).另一方面,KNPLabs使用特征,并得到KNP的支持.
还有什么理由在Symfony2的doc中提到Atlantic18而不是KNPLabs的?
我有以下代码
$xl = new PHPExcel();
$sheet = xl->setActiveSheetIndex(0)
$sheet->getStyle('A')->getNumberFormat()->setFormatCode('#,##0.00');
$format = $sheet->getStyle('A')->getNumberFormat()->getFormatCode();
Run Code Online (Sandbox Code Playgroud)
我希望$ format包含#,##0.00但它包含General.
我错过了什么吗?
PHPExcel v.1.7.6